Output ecea0fb357f04dda6e6c1e8779bc0c7c8fff37cf9f3eb35c299322cbee87a756:1

value
10842748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6ec1020afb7bf063805451de02036d5d933ebe9 OP_EQUAL
address
3MHRKYHMquouNMuUU3rffBtgFu3JSTdMXg
transaction
ecea0fb357f04dda6e6c1e8779bc0c7c8fff37cf9f3eb35c299322cbee87a756
confirmations
338069
spent
true